Prime Minister Han Duck-soo visited an area in Cheongju, North Chungcheong Province, that was severely affected by recent heavy rains and flooding. During his visit on July 11, he inspected the site of the inundation and ordered a nationwide survey of areas prone to flooding and water damage. Inspection of Flood Damage in Cheongju Prime Minister Han visited the Mochoong-dong neighborhood in Seowon-gu, Cheongju City, which experienced significant flooding due to heavy rainfall on July 8-9. With his military service nearing its end, Gimcheon Sangmu midfielder Park Chul-woo is reflecting on his remaining time with the club and expressing a strong desire for positive results. Park, who enlisted in April 2023, is set to be discharged on October 6th, leaving him with just over 100 days of his conscription period. He shared his feelings after the recent match against Jeju United in the Hana One Q K League 1 2026. The United States government has declassified a significant trove of documents, military footage, and photographs related to Unidentified Anomalous Phenomena (UAP), commonly known as UFOs. This latest release includes previously undisclosed accounts of unidentified flying objects sighted in East Asian airspace and a diamond-shaped object observed near nuclear weapons facilities, sparking renewed public interest. Pentagon Discloses Fourth Batch of UAP Data The Department of Defense (DoD) officially unveiled the fourth installment of its UAP-related classified materials on its public website, as reported by international news outlets. An invitation for South Korean football stars Son Heung-min and Hwang Hee-chan to appear as witnesses before a parliamentary committee has been rescinded following significant criticism from fans and football circles. The initial proposal aimed to gather testimony regarding issues within the Korean Football Association (KFA). Parliamentary Committee Seeks Testimony on KFA Issues The National Assembly’s Culture, Sports, and Tourism Committee had planned to hold a hearing on July 22nd to discuss the KFA’s operational matters. Authorities have launched an investigation following the discovery of a soldier in his 20s, found deceased at a military unit in Gyeonggi Province. The incident occurred on the evening of July 10th, when the soldier, identified as Sergeant A, was found unresponsive at a South Korean Army base in Seongnam City. Discovery and Initial Response Emergency services were alerted by the military unit and responded to the scene. Upon arrival, Sergeant A was transported to a nearby military hospital.
